Core Performance Modulators

Your protocol is engineered around several key hormonal axes that directly govern cognitive and physical output. The objective is a synchronized system where each component supports the others.

  • The Testosterone Axis Its role in maintaining memory, attention, and spatial abilities is well-documented. Optimizing this pathway is foundational for drive and cognitive confidence.
  • The Estrogen Axis This hormone is vital for brain health, supporting synaptic plasticity, which is the brain’s ability to form new connections for learning and memory. Proper levels are integral to verbal fluency and recall.
  • The Cortisol Axis Chronic high levels of this stress hormone can physically degrade the hippocampus, the brain’s memory center. A calibrated protocol focuses on managing cortisol output to protect neural architecture.
  • The Metabolic Axis Insulin resistance is linked to cognitive decline and inflammation in the brain. Maintaining metabolic efficiency is a core component of protecting brain function.
